摘要

The polarity effect of microdischarge and the characteristics of ozone generation were studied using electrical and optical methods, paying attention to the distribution of microdischarges in terras of time and space and the effect of dielectric surface on microdischarge. As a result, the phenomenon in which a chain of microdischarges occurs in a brief period of time could be observed for the first time. In addition, it was found that the microdischarge characteristic, collective microdischarge phenomenon, and ozone yield vary according to the surface condition of the dielectric electrode used. The ozone yield was high with a glass surface and low with a ceramic surface.
